Title: **Inventor Profile: Hans Schafer**
Introduction
Hans Schafer is an innovative inventor located in Gomaringen, Germany. With a strong background in cutting-edge technology, Schafer has made significant contributions to the field of processing tools, securing a total of three patents to date.
Latest Patents
Schafer's most recent patents include a groundbreaking **cutting plate for a processing tool** and its corresponding **holding device**. His design for the cutting plate illustrates an advanced approach, featuring a blade that protrudes radially from a central body. This unique configuration incorporates a coupling part that allows for efficient mounting onto the holding device, which is defined by a longitudinal axis. The coupling part also has driving surfaces that enable torque transmission from the holding device to the cutting plate. Furthermore, he designed a shaped part to create a secure fixing device on the holding device's seat.
Another notable patent is the **holding device for machine tool inserts**, which features a specially designed recess bounded by clamping jaws to securely hold the insert. This holding device integrates a slot that accommodates a spreading body of a spreader key, enhancing the clamping mechanism's efficiency. This innovative design has a half-circular expansion that serves as a receptacle for the spreading body, further exemplifying Schafer's commitment to enhancing machining processes.
Career Highlights
Hans Schafer is currently associated with Hartmetall-Werkzeugfabrik Paul Horn GmbH, a company recognized for its groundbreaking advancements in cutting tool technologies. His role involves developing innovative solutions that improve efficiency and effectiveness in the manufacturing industry.
